| Insert Identity Confirmation | Creative Biolabs verifies all retroviral vectors by a PCR-based proviral integration check. In brief, cells are transduced with serial dilutions of the retroviral preparation and, after several days, genomic DNA is extracted. A predefined segment of the expected retroviral insert is then amplified by PCR to confirm correct identity and integration. |
| Full Name | Protein Phosphatase 1 Regulatory Subunit 3D |
| Alternative Name | PPP1R6 |
| Location | 20q13.33 |
| Gene ID | 5509 |
| Summary | This gene produces a glycogen-targeting subunit of PP1, directing the phosphatase to glycogen particles and influencing enzyme localization and substrate selection. |
